Cases — May 8th through 14th

admin - May 21, 2016 - Discrimination, Due Process, Tenth Circuit, Workers Compensation, Wrongful Termination
Contract/Noncompete/Trade Secret/Wrongful Termination

*Winger v. Meade District Hospital (10th Cir., May 12, 2016) (affirming summary judgment in favor of the hospital on Winger’s liberty interest claim, but reversing as to Winger’s property interest claim in continued employment)


Discrimination/Retaliation

*Glapion v. Castro (HUD Secretary) (10th Cir., May 12, 2016) (affirming summary judgment in favor of HUD on Glapion’s discrimination, retaliation, hostile work environment, FLSA, and FOIA claims)


Workers Compensation/Occupational Safety and Disease


Smith v. Colvin (10th Cir., May 9, 2016) (affirming ALJ determination that Smith was not disabled)

*Cases marked with an asterisk are cases the 10th Circuit does not consider binding precedent except under the doctrines of law of the case, res judicata, or collateral estoppel.  They may be cited, however, for persuasive value under Fed.R.App.P. 32.1 and 10th Cir.R. 32.1.
